What is the difference between Freelance Labview Software Engineer vs Embedded Software Engineer?

AspectFreelance Labview Software EngineerEmbedded Software Engineer
CredentialsTypically requires a degree in engineering or computer science, LabVIEW certification is a plusRequires a degree in electrical, computer engineering, or related field; embedded systems certifications are common
Work EnvironmentFreelance projects, remote or on-site, often contract-basedFull-time or contract roles within companies, often on-site or hybrid
Industry UsageUsed in automation, testing, data acquisition, and control systemsUsed in consumer electronics, automotive, aerospace, and industrial systems

The main difference is that Freelance Labview Software Engineers work independently on specialized projects using LabVIEW, while Embedded Software Engineers develop software for embedded hardware within organizations. The former focuses on LabVIEW-based applications, often freelance, whereas the latter works on embedded systems across various industries.
